What's the radius of a circle with an area of 64 square feet?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Nady [450]3 years ago
6 0
Area = \pi r ^{2}
64 = \pi r ^{2}
\frac{64}{ \pi } =r^2
r= \frac{ \sqrt{64} }{ \sqrt{ \pi } } = \frac{8}{ \sqrt{ \pi } }

If you want the denominator rationalized, the answer is \frac{8 \sqrt{ \pi } }{ \pi }
